Things To Do in Colonial Beach VA

Visit Colonial Beach, Virginia

Colonial Beach is a charming oceanside community located on Virginia’s Northern Neck peninsula. It has long been celebrated for its stunning scenery, unique culture, and maritime heritage. The town is home to a number of noteworthy attractions, including a beautiful beach where you can soak up the sun or take a dip in the ocean.

Yacht Club and beach, Colonial Beach, Virginia
Yacht Club and beach, Colonial Beach, Virginia by Boston Public Library

There are also plenty of restaurants to choose from, offering delicious local cuisine and fresh seafood. And if you’re feeling adventurous, you can explore the area’s many outdoor activities like fishing, kayaking, sailing and more. There are also plenty of historical sites to visit, giving you an opportunity to learn more about this fascinating corner of the country. Colonial Beach is truly a one-of-a-kind destination that has something for everyone.

Top Colonial Beach Destinations

With its wide selection of restaurants, attractions, and activities, Colonial Beach has something for everyone. Here are 10 of the best things to do in Colonial Beach:

The Beach

One of the highlights of Colonial Beach is its stunning beaches. With miles of sandy shores along the Potomac River, visitors can relax, sunbathe, and take a refreshing dip in the crystal-clear waters. The beaches offer breathtaking views, especially during sunrise and sunset, making it a perfect spot for nature lovers and photographers alike.

Colonial Beach
Colonial Beach by Virginia Sea Grant

Colonial Beach Municipal Pier

This expansive pier offers stunning views of the Potomac River and is home to a variety of restaurants, shops, and attractions. Visitors can enjoy fishing off the pier or take a leisurely stroll down its length. There’s also a playground, ice cream stand, and plenty of seating to relax and take it all in.

Colonial Beach Municipal Pier
Colonial Beach Municipal Pier by joelogon

Colonial Beach Brewing

Founded in 2016, Colonial Beach Brewing is committed to crafting delicious craft beer, cider, and mead that is reflective of the area’s culture and heritage. Stop in for a pint or two, and sample some of their classic favorites as well as seasonal beers.

Museum at Colonial Beach

One of the must-visit attractions is the Colonial Beach Museum, which is a treasure trove of artifacts and exhibits that showcase the town’s past. From Native American history to the early settlers and the rise of tourism in the area, the museum provides a comprehensive overview of Colonial Beach’s journey through time.

Peddlers Market

A unique shopping experience awaits you at Peddlers Market. Browse through an eclectic array of antique furniture, vintage clothing, handmade jewelry, artwork, and more. It’s an ideal destination for those seeking one-of-a-kind items for their home or wardrobe.

Monroe Bay Lighthouse

This historic lighthouse, built in the 1850s, served as a guiding light for ships navigating the Potomac River. Today, it stands as a testament to the maritime heritage of Colonial Beach and offers panoramic views of the surrounding area.

Fort Monroe Virginia Va. Lighthouse Old Point Comfort Light
Fort Monroe Virginia Va. Lighthouse Old Point Comfort Light by watts_photos

Colonial Beach Games & Soda Fountain

Take a step back in time at this charming games store and soda fountain. Grab a milkshake or float and then head over to the arcade and play a round of skeeball or pinball. The kids (and adults!) in your group will have a blast.

Alexander House

This historic home, built in 1891, is a beautiful example of Victorian architecture and offers a glimpse into the lives of the town’s early residents. Take a guided tour and learn about the house’s unique features and the stories of those who once called it home.

Colonial Beach Yacht Center

If you’re looking for an unforgettable experience, take a tour of the harbor with Colonial Beach Yacht Center. Enjoy the spectacular scenery while cruising on one of their luxurious yachts, and top off the experience with a gourmet dinner from their onboard chefs. It’s the perfect way to end any day in Colonial Beach.

Colonial Beach Yacht Center
Colonial Beach Yacht Center; image via

Whether you’re staying for a few days or just passing through, these five attractions offer plenty of opportunities to explore and enjoy the beauty of Colonial Beach.

Colonial Beach Motor Speedway

If you’re a history buff, don’t miss the chance to explore the remnants of the Colonial Beach Motor Speedway. This former racetrack, which operated from the 1940s to the 1970s, hosted legendary drivers and races that attracted crowds from near and far. Although the speedway is no longer in operation, you can still see the remnants of the track and imagine the roar of the engines and the excitement that once filled the air.

Voorhees Preserve

Nature enthusiasts will be delighted by the extensive trail system that winds through the area. The  Voorhees Nature Preserve provides a serene escape into the wilderness. As you hike along the trail, you will encounter a variety of flora and fauna, including towering trees, vibrant wildflowers, and perhaps even some wildlife. The trail offers an opportunity to immerse yourself in the natural wonders of the area and provides a peaceful respite from the bustling city life.

Voorhees Preserve in Virginia
Voorhees Preserve; image via

Colonial Beach Water Activities

When it comes to experiencing the true essence of Colonial Beach, Virginia, engaging in water activities is an absolute must.


Hop aboard a boat and set sail on the calm waters of the Potomac River, where you can enjoy breathtaking views of the surrounding natural beauty. Whether you prefer a peaceful cruise or an exhilarating speedboat ride, the river offers a serene and idyllic setting for a memorable day on the water.


Fishing enthusiasts will be delighted by the abundance of fish species that inhabit the waters of Colonial Beach. Cast your line and try your luck at catching striped bass, catfish, perch, or even the prized blue crab. The town is known for its fishing pier and public access points, providing ample opportunities for anglers of all skill levels.

Water Sports

For those seeking a bit more adventure, Colonial Beach offers a range of exciting water sports activities. From jet skiing and kayaking to paddleboarding and wakeboarding, there is something for everyone to enjoy. Feel the rush of adrenaline as you zip across the water or navigate through the gentle currents, immersing yourself in the thrill of these exhilarating water sports.


Colonial Beach Also hosts various water-centric events throughout the year, such as the annual Jet Ski Races and the Potomac River Festival, further highlighting the town’s vibrant water culture. These events offer a unique opportunity to witness skilled water sports competitors in action and experience the exhilaration of being part of a lively and enthusiastic crowd.

Must-visit Restaurants and Cafes

This charming waterfront town offers a variety of restaurants and cafes that showcase the best of local and international flavors.

Lighthouse Restaurant

Located right on the Potomac River, this iconic eatery offers stunning views and fresh seafood dishes that are simply exquisite. From steamed crabs and succulent shrimp to perfectly grilled fish, every bite is a taste of the ocean’s bounty.

Wilkerson’s Seafood Restaurant

This family-owned establishment has been serving up homestyle cooking for over 60 years. Indulge in their famous fried chicken, creamy mac and cheese, and fluffy biscuits for a truly satisfying meal.

Colonial Beach Wilkerson's Seafood Restaurant
Wilkerson’s Seafood Restaurant, Colonial Beach VA; image via facebook

Tides Inn Market

This hidden gem offers a unique dining experience with its fusion of Mediterranean and Middle Eastern flavors. From flavorful kebabs to savory falafel wraps, every dish is prepared with the freshest ingredients and bursts with authentic flavors.

Colonial Buzz Coffee Bar

This cozy cafe not only serves up delicious coffee and espresso drinks but also offers a warm and welcoming atmosphere. Sip on a perfectly crafted latte or enjoy a homemade pastry while taking in the town’s laid-back vibe.

Live Entertainment and Events

Colonial Beach, Virginia, may be a small town, but it is brimming with live entertainment and events that are sure to delight both locals and visitors alike.

Custom T’s Motorsports Park

This iconic venue hosts thrilling drag racing events that attract racing enthusiasts from near and far. The roar of the engines and the adrenaline-filled atmosphere make for an unforgettable experience.

Custom T's Motorsports Park | Venue | Colonial Beach, Va
Custom T’s Motorsports Park; image via

Colonial Beach Boardwalk

This picturesque waterfront promenade sets the stage for regular live music performances, featuring a variety of genres that cater to all musical tastes. From local bands to talented solo artists, you’ll find yourself tapping your feet and swaying to the rhythm of the music while enjoying the stunning views of the Potomac River.

Colonial Beach Blues Festival

This annual event brings together celebrated blues musicians who deliver soulful performances that will leave you mesmerized. Immerse yourself in the melodic tunes, indulge in delicious food and drinks from local vendors, and join fellow music lovers in celebrating the rich history of blues.

Colonial Beach Blues Festival
Colonial Beach Blues Festival by Sea Nettles Photography

Beyond music, Colonial Beach also hosts a range of other events throughout the year, including art festivals, craft fairs, and cultural celebrations. These events showcase the talents of local artists, artisans, and performers, giving you a chance to explore the town’s creative spirit and immerse yourself in its vibrant community.

Day Trips from Colonial Beach

Whether you’re seeking natural beauty, historical landmarks, or exciting adventures, there are plenty of hidden gems just a short distance from Colonial Beach.

George Washington Birthplace National Monument

George Washington Birthplace National Monument is about 30 minutes away. This historic site allows visitors to step back in time and learn about the life and legacy of the first U.S. President. Explore the replica of Washington’s birthplace, stroll through the beautiful gardens, and immerse yourself in the history of this iconic figure.

Day trip to Westmoreland State Park

Only a short drive from Colonial Beach, this state park boasts stunning views of the Potomac River and offers a range of activities for nature enthusiasts. Hike along scenic trails, go fishing or boating, or simply relax on the sandy beach.

Barefoot boy on beach fossil beach Westmoreland State Park
Barefoot boy on beach fossil beach Westmoreland State Park by vastateparksstaff

Stratford Hall

This historic plantation was the birthplace of Robert E. Lee and offers guided tours of the beautifully preserved mansion and grounds. Explore the gardens, learn about the Lee family’s history, and enjoy the serene ambiance of this remarkable estate.

Day Trip to Shark Tooth Island

Located just off the coast of Colonial Beach, this small island is known for its abundance of fossilized shark teeth. Take a boat tour or rent a kayak to reach the island, and spend the day combing the shores for these fascinating relics from the past.

Shark Tooth Island
Shark Tooth Island by Sea Nettles Photography

Final Word

We hope you enjoyed our blog post about the hidden gems of Colonial Beach, VA. This charming town has so much to offer, from its pristine beaches to its rich history and unique attractions. By exploring the hidden gems we’ve shared, you’ll be able to create unforgettable memories and have a truly immersive experience in this beautiful destination. So, grab your sunscreen, camera, and sense of adventure, and get ready to discover the hidden treasures of Colonial Beach, VA!

Share on: